The role of adiponectin and leptin in the treatment of ovarian cancer patients

Abstract: Introduction: Ovarian cancer is most frequently detected in the advanced stage. Although its pathogenesis is not fully elucidated, it is assumed that body susceptibility and hormonal disorders are responsible. The role of some cytokines as predictors in the treatment process is still investigated. The aim of the study was to determine the relationship of adiponectin and leptin with the disease severity and response to chemotherapy. “…The correlation between leptin levels and cancer differs according to cancer types. Leptin levels are lower in patients with gastric and colon cancers [ 82 , 83 ] whereas higher in patients with breast [ 84 ] and ovarian cancers [ 85 ]. Since anorexia, hyper-metabolism, and inflammatory acute phase response play a role in the development of cancer cachexia, increased leptin secretion has been suggested to be involved in the onset of this pathology.…”
